A Psalm of David 1 Give unto the LORD, O ye sons of the mighty, Give unto the LORD glory and strength. 2 Give unto the LORD the glory due unto his name; Worship the LORD in the beauty of holiness. 3 The voice of the LORD is upon the waters: The God of glory thundereth, Even the LORD upon many waters. 4 The voice of the LORD is powerful; The voice of the LORD is full of majesty. 5 The voice of the LORD breaketh the cedars; Yea, the LORD breaketh in pieces the cedars of Lebanon. 6 He maketh them also to skip like a calf; Lebanon and Sirion like a young wild-ox. 7 The voice of the LORD cleaveth the flames of fire. 8 The voice of the LORD shaketh the wilderness; The LORD shaketh the wilderness of Kadesh. 9 The voice of the LORD maketh the hinds to calve, And strippeth the forests bare: And in his temple every thing saith, Glory. 10 The LORD sat as king at the Flood; Yea, the LORD sitteth as king for ever. 11 The LORD will give strength unto his people; the LORD will bless his people with peace. |
